Juventus Football Club wishes to express appreciation for the conduct and support of the Polizia di Stato, in particular the Digos who operate within Questura di Torino, for identifying and charging the Genoa fan who broke a seat in the away section of Juventus Stadium. The supporter, who went on to throw parts of the broken seat towards a nearby section, was also spotted thanks to the surveillance systems used inside the stadium.
